About

ByteAsk Embedded MCP

Page-cited answers from embedded & firmware reference docs — for coding agents that can't afford to guess a register value.

ByteAsk Embedded MCP is the open-source server behind ByteAsk Embedded Docs: a source-grounded, page-cited evidence-retrieval MCP server for coding agents (Claude Code, Codex, Cursor) that write firmware / driver / protocol code and need exact facts — SunSpec points, register offsets, Modbus function codes, trip thresholds, SCPI commands, API symbols.

It returns verbatim snippets with page citations — never an authored answer — and when nothing is relevant enough it says no match rather than fabricate. Every document is treated equally: no authority layer, no filters.

> [!NOTE] > What's in this repo: the MCP server — tools, transports (stdio + Streamable > HTTP), bearer auth, DNS-rebinding protection, result rendering — plus a small, > pluggable retrieval interface. > > What's not in this repo: the retrieval engine and the document corpus. How > documents are parsed, chunked, embedded, and ranked, and the licensed source > material itself, sit behind the [SearchBackend](src/byteaskembeddedmcp/backend.py) > seam and power the hosted endpoint at https://mcp.byteask.ai/mcp. This repo ships > an in-memory [SampleBackend](src/byteaskembeddedmcp/backend.py) (a few > illustrative, public-knowledge records) so the server runs out of the box.

Why

  • Cited, or nothing. Every hit is verbatim source text with a section + page

citation. On a miss it returns an honest "no confident match" — it never invents a register value.

  • Built for coding agents. The tool descriptions and triggers are tuned so agents

call search_docs reflexively the moment they see a hex literal, a Modbus code, an IEEE clause, a SCPI verb, or an MCU part number — before answering from memory.

  • Two transports, one server. stdio for local agents, Streamable HTTP for hosted.
  • Bring your own retrieval. The search engine is a two-method interface — swap in

anything behind BYTEASK_BACKEND without touching the server.

  • Zero-setup demo. The bundled SampleBackend runs immediately. No API keys.

Quickstart

Requires Python ≥ 3.10 and uv.

uv sync
uv run byteask-embedded-mcp        # run as an MCP server (stdio)

That's it — the bundled SampleBackend serves a couple of illustrative records, so search_docs works immediately. Run the offline tests with uv run pytest.

Tools

Input is natural language (or an exact identifier). Output is compact markdown.

| Tool | What it does | |------|--------------| | search_docs(query, limit=8) | Search the corpus; return ranked, page-cited evidence. Each hit has a document title, a section + page citation, the verbatim snippet, and a result_id. A "no confident match" response means not found — do not fabricate. | | get_context(result_id) | Expand a hit to its full source section. | | request_document(request) | Ask for a missing document to be added (logged server-side). |

Example output:

## Results for "what Modbus function code writes multiple registers"

### Sample — Modbus Application Protocol (illustrative) — §6.12, p.30
> Function code 16 (0x10), Write Multiple Registers, writes a block of contiguous
> holding registers (1 to 123 registers) in a remote device. ...
_ref: sample:modbus-fc16_

Plug in your own retrieval

The server depends only on a two-method interface ([backend.py](src/byteaskembeddedmcp/backend.py)):

class SearchBackend(Protocol):
    def search(self, query, limit=8, effort=None) -> dict: ...
    def get_context(self, result_id, effort=None) -> dict: ...

Implement it, expose a factory make_backend(config) -> SearchBackend, and point the server at it:

BYTEASK_BACKEND="my_pkg.my_module:make_backend"

The exact return-value contracts are documented at the top of backend.py.

Configuration

All settings are environment variables (loaded from .env; see [.env.example](.env.example)).

| Variable | Default | Notes | |----------|---------|-------| | BYTEASK_BACKEND | — | module:callable returning a SearchBackend; empty → SampleBackend | | BYTEASK_LOGS | logs | where query / request JSONL logs are written | | MCP_TRANSPORT | stdio | stdio (local agents) or http | | MCP_HTTP_HOST / MCP_HTTP_PORT | 127.0.0.1 / 8000 | HTTP bind address | | MCP_HTTP_AUTH_TOKEN | — | bearer token for HTTP (empty = unauthenticated, dev only) | | MCP_ALLOWED_HOSTS | — | comma-separated hosts allowed in the Host header (* disables) | | LOG_LEVEL | INFO | stderr log verbosity |

Running over HTTP

MCP_TRANSPORT=http MCP_HTTP_AUTH_TOKEN=$(openssl rand -hex 32) \
  uv run byteask-embedded-mcp --host 0.0.0.0 --port 8000

Clients then send Authorization: Bearer . The bundled bearer check is a shared-secret stub — replace it with real auth (OAuth 2.1 resource server, mTLS, or a trusted reverse proxy) before exposing publicly. DNS-rebinding protection stays on independently via MCP_ALLOWED_HOSTS.

Project layout

src/byteask_embedded_mcp/
  server.py     # FastMCP app + 3 tools (search_docs, get_context, request_document)
  backend.py    # SearchBackend protocol + in-memory SampleBackend (swap for real retrieval)
  render.py     # structured result -> compact markdown
  http_auth.py  # Streamable HTTP entrypoint + stub bearer-token guard
  config.py     # server config (transport, logging, backend selection)
  schemas.py    # Hit / Section result types
  obs.py        # per-call JSONL logging
tests/          # offline unit tests (renderer, backend, server tools)
assets/         # README demo GIF + its deterministic generator

Security

  • stdout stays clean in stdio mode (it is the JSON-RPC channel); all logs go to

stderr / logs/*.jsonl.

  • The HTTP bearer check is a stub — unauthenticated if no token is set, a shared

secret at best. Harden it before exposing widely.

  • DNS-rebinding protection is on by default for the HTTP transport.

Contributing

PRs and issues are welcome.

uv sync            # install (incl. dev tools)
uv run pytest      # run the offline test suite

A few conventions to keep the server clean:

  • The backend seam is the extension point. Retrieval internals (parsing, chunking,

embeddings, ranking) are intentionally out of scope here — build them behind SearchBackend in your own package, not in this repo.

  • Keep the dependency surface small and the stdio path free of the HTTP stack.
  • Add a test for new behavior; the suite is fully offline (no network, no keys).
